Among all Oregon counties, Multnomah had the highest Non-Hispanic Black Alone citizen population (40.10K), followed by Washington (10.59K), and Clackamas (3.48K).

In terms of percentages, Multnomah had the highest percentage of its citizen population being Non-Hispanic Black Alone (5.30%), followed by Washington (1.96%), and Malheur (1.12%).

County Citizen Population % of County Citizen Population
Multnomah 40105 5.30
Washington 10585 1.96
Clackamas 3475 0.87
Lane 3445 0.94
Marion 3005 0.95
Jackson 1605 0.76
Deschutes 1000 0.53
Yamhill 790 0.78
Benton 770 0.90
Umatilla 755 1.05
Linn 620 0.50
Douglas 600 0.55
Polk 530 0.65
Josephine 510 0.60
Klamath 430 0.66
Malheur 320 1.12
Clatsop 280 0.72
Columbia 255 0.49
Coos 220 0.35
Union 185 0.71
Jefferson 175 0.75
Baker 170 1.07
Crook 155 0.66
Hood River 140 0.69
Tillamook 135 0.52
Lincoln 110 0.23
Wallowa 50 0.71
Wasco 40 0.16
Curry 35 0.16
Lake 25 0.33
Morrow 25 0.25
Harney 20 0.28
Sherman 4 0.24
Gilliam 0 0.00
Grant 0 0.00
Wheeler 0 0.00
